1. Pantheon
The Pantheon in Rome, a marvel of ancient engineering, stands as a testament to Roman architectural brilliance. Its iconic dome and oculus create a celestial atmosphere, while the well-preserved interior showcases stunning marble and artistic details. Originally a temple dedicated to all gods, the Pantheon's enduring legacy draws visitors to marvel at its grandeur and historical significance, making it a timeless symbol of Rome's cultural heritage.

5. Circo Massimo
The Circus Maximus in Rome, an ancient chariot racing stadium, could hold over 250,000 spectators. Built in the 6th century BC, it remains a symbol of Roman engineering and a venue for public events today.

7. Spanish Steps
The Spanish Steps in Rome, built in 1725, connect Piazza di Spagna to the Trinità dei Monti church. Featuring 135 elegant steps, they are a symbol of Baroque architecture and a popular tourist attraction.
